Transaction 3c91c62763704546a84a6980204b873092db541987160c79b9c43ab62ebd78be

1 Input
2 Outputs
  • 3c91c62763704546a84a6980204b873092db541987160c79b9c43ab62ebd78be:0
  • value  289223
    address  1EJd9u1JbmwtWk89B8snD2PzAukJQ3u34d
  • 3c91c62763704546a84a6980204b873092db541987160c79b9c43ab62ebd78be:1
  • value  2775584
    address  3QEHApKoGutanfJ7KCqwgtaBfjckyt2cXK